When performing welding repairs on a vehicle equipped with a 12 VDC battery, you should take precautions to ensure the battery is disconnected or the vehicle's electrical system is properly protected. Welding produces high heat and can generate electrical currents that may damage the battery or the electronic components in the vehicle. To prevent any damage, you can either disconnect the negative terminal of the battery or use a specialized welding blanket to protect the battery and other electronic components.
